Abstract
OBJECTIVE: To investigate the immunohistochemical localization of insulin-like growth factor 1 (IGF-1) and IGF-1 receptor (IGF-1R) in archival specimens of sporadic schwannoma.Entities:

Demographic and clinical characteristics of patients (n = 29) with schwannomas who were included in this study to investigate the immunohistochemical localization of insulin-like growth factor 1 and insulin-like growth factor 1 receptor.
| Characteristic | Patients with schwannomas |
|---|---|
| Sex, male/female | 16/13 |
| Age, years | 57.6 ± 2.8 |
| Maximum tumour dimension, cm | 3.4 ± 0.5[ |
| Site of tumour occurrence | |
| Intracranial | 3 (10.3) |
| Cervical, limbs | 11 (37.9) |
| Spinal | 2 (6.9) |
| Mediastinum | 2 (6.9) |
| Thoracic wall | 1 (3.4) |
| Retroperitoneum | 10 (34.5) |
Data presented as mean ± SE or n of patients (%).
Unknown for six patients.

Figure 2.Representative photomicrographs showing the insulin-like growth factor 1 (IGF-1) and insulin-like growth factor 1 receptor (IGF-1R) immunoreactivity in the schwannoma specimen from patient number 11 and human liver (positive control tissue). IGF-1 was detected mainly in the cytoplasm and partly in the perinuclear area, whereas IGF-1R was detected only in cytoplasm in the human liver. A nonspecific response was not found in the negative control patient number 11 (No. 11) when 0.01 M phosphate-buffered saline (pH 7.4) was used instead of primary antibody.
